Practical Considerations for Long-Term Use

Adopting a font like Bride for ongoing work involves considerations beyond the initial design. Organization is one. If you accumulate many fonts, keeping your Bride files well-labeled and in a dedicated project folder aids future retrieval. Efficiency is also impacted by its usage. Because Bride is delicate, it performs best at larger sizes or with sufficient line spacing. Testing it across various outputs—print proofs, screen resolutions—is a part of a thorough implementation process to ensure readability is never compromised.

Furthermore, Bride interacts with other decisions in your brand toolkit. It often pairs effectively with clean, minimalist sans-serif fonts for body text or supporting information. This combination allows Bride to shine as an accent while maintaining overall usability. For example, on a wedding website, you might use Bride for the couple’s names and headings, and a simple sans-serif for the descriptive paragraphs. This kind of thoughtful font pairing, decided during your brand preparation phase, ensures long-term versatility across mediums.
